Publisher's Synopsis

Drawing on her own work at Attica prison in New York and information from elsewhere, Collins discusses the history of US prisons and African American women in them, criminology, crimes committed, the children of prisoners, prison health, alternatives to incarceration, the intent and impact of the recent Crime Bill, and an international perspective.
